The gene is a distinct portion of a cell's DNA. Genes are coded instructions for making all the body needs, mainly proteins. Human beings have about 25,000 genes. Researchers have discovered what some of our genes do and have found some which are related with disorders like as cystic fibrosis or Huntington's disease. There are, though, various genes whose functions are still unknown.
Genes are packaged in bundles called as chromosomes. Humans have 23 pairs of chromosomes for a total of 46. Of those, 1 pair is the sex chromosomes verifies whether you are male or female, plus some other body characteristics, and the other 22 pairs are autosomal chromosomes verify the rest of the body's makeup.
